Jamie Lee is officially known at Lady Haden-Guest as of 2010. The current heir to the peerage is Christopher's brother.
|
A picture of her in a tiara when her husband still held a hereditary seat in the house of lords. She attended the opening of parliament.
BBC NEWS | Special Report | 1998 | 11/98 | Queen Speech | Film star peers into parliament
Her and Christopher have 2 children, a son and daughter, but they are adopted. They are allowed the courtesy titles of children of a baron, but because they are adopted, ineligible to inherit. There is also an older half-brother Anthony, but as he was born before his parents were wed, he was ineligible to inherit and the title passed to Chris.

The actress and former model Jocelyn Lane married Prince Alfonso of Hohenlohe-Langenburg in Marbella, Spain, in February 1971. In 1984, her marriage to Prince Alfonso ended in a divorce in which she received a million-dollar settlement.
On June 7, 2003, when she was 19 years old, Olivia Wilde married Prince Tao Ruspoli, an Italian filmmaker, photographer and musician, second son of occasional actor and aristocrat Prince Alessandro Ruspoli, 9th Prince of Cerveteri. On 8 February 2011, they announced that they were separating. The divorce was finalized on 29 September 2011.
On 2 december 1947 Italian actress Laura Adani married Duke Luigi Visconti di Modrone, and in 1969 she married Ernesto Balbo Bertone, Count of Sambuy, Duke of Nochera.
Actress Olga Villi married in 1953 nobleman Raimondo Lanza di Trabia.
Actress Maria Michi married in 1949 Prince Augusto Torlonia.
Popular italian actress Clara Calamai married Count Leonardo Bonzi.
Actor Giancarlo Sbragia married princess (and actress) Esmeralda Ruspoli.
Hollywoodian star Henry Fonda was married to italian baroness Afdera Franchetti from 1957 to 1961.
French actor Georges Brehat maried italian princess Giovanna Pinatelli.
Prince Frederick Windsor, the son of Prince and Princess Michael of Kent, is married to the actress Sophie Winkleman. They married in Hampton Court Palace on 12 September 2009. By virtue of her marriage, she became entitled to be styled as Lady Frederick Windsor.
Mexican actress Rosita Arena is married to Spanish aristocrat Jaime de Mora y Aragón, brother of Queen Fabiola of Belgium. The marriage lasted 2 mounths.
Hollywood star Jessica Chastain is married to Gian Luca Passi di Preposulo, an Italian count of the Passi de Preposulo noble family.
Rita Jenrette is a former american actress and television journalist from Texas and she married Prince Nicolo Boncompagni Ludovisi of Piombino. They live in his 16th century family home in Rome, called the Villa Aurora, or sometimes Casino Ludovisi.
